The Flexibility You Need at a Cost You Can Afford
Hiring an in-house CFO comes with a big commitment: salary, benefits, onboarding, and long-term expectations. For many businesses, that just doesn’t make sense yet.
Outsourced CFOs (also called fractional CFOs) offer the same strategic leadership, but on a part-time or project basis. Whether you need a few hours a month or full oversight for a quarter, we tailor our involvement to match your business needs and budget.
Strategic Value Without the Overhead
The real power of outsourcing is that you get focused expertise exactly when you need it. As a fractional CFO, we step in to:
- Build financial forecasts
- Analyze pricing and margins
- Help you prepare for funding or expansion
- Improve cash flow management
- Develop financial systems and reporting structures
You get the guidance to move your business forward, without the overhead of a full-time hire.
Fresh Perspective, Broader Experience
Outsourced CFOs often work across multiple industries and business models. That means we’re exposed to more challenges, tested solutions, and best practices than someone who’s spent years at just one company.
When we work with a client, we are bringing not just technical skill—but insights learned from helping other businesses overcome similar financial obstacles.
When to Consider Outsourcing
You may not need a CFO in-house, but if any of the following apply, outsourced support is likely a great fit:
- You're preparing for a big decision (funding, hiring, expansion)
- Your books are clean, but you don't know what your numbers mean
- You're growing fast and want to stay ahead of cash flow or costs
- You need financial clarity, but not a full-time executive
